.DISCUSSION...

Northwest winds gusting in the 30 to 45 mph range will persist
into through the afternoon at the site. Winds will diminish
through this evening, becoming light and southwesterly overnight.
Expect excellent relative humidity recoveries tonight. Look for
southeast winds on Tuesday, with gusts to around 20 mph along with
minimum relative humidities in the mid 20s to 30 percent. The
chance for precipitation is very low (less than 10 percent)
through the Tuesday. Matos
